I stay in hotels 200+ nights a year, both for work as a healthcare professional traveling around the U.S. and for leisure in Asia, where I live. In recent memory this is the ABSOLUTE WORST hotel that I have stayed in. Saying it is HORRIBLE is not an apt description. Think worse, MUCH WORSE. Staff were rude, insolent, indifferent and were the least representative of "hospitality" that you could imagine. My wife and I were traveling separately because I was flying back home from the U.S. and she was coming from up island. We normally stay in a much better hotel each time I get back from an overseas contract, but our usual hotel was booked out. The hotel looked "okay" on the website. Not in real life. Despite numerous emails and texts, one that very morning, about my wife arriving ahead of me and occupying the room the front desk staff made her sit in the lobby for 2+ hours because the room was "Not ready". The only thing that would have made this room ready was a wrecking ball. This hotel has set a new sub-standard of excellence. If you lowered the bar any further a snake couldn't slither under it. Grime, filth, rust, the bathroom vent fan hanging out of the ceiling, the room "safe", a shoebox sized box, didn't work, but no worries, it had been ripped from the wall previously, so you could just carry it with you under one arm. Just getting into the room was an adventure as the entry tile was buckled so that you couldn't open the entry door completely. You couldn't open the adjacent closet door either, but that really didn't matter since this hotel does not provide hangers. Really. No hangers. The pool, viewed from our room, might have been inviting to cool off, if it hadn't been for the lovely "Frog Pond Green" hue of the water. We asked for extra towels and an extra pillow. Those come at a cost. The next day housekeeping took the clean (extra) towels out of the room, but left the dirty ones on the floor. Then the front desk called and said that we needed to pay the "daily rental" for the extra pillow. Otherwise they would be sending someone up to collect it. After the 2nd night we'd had enough. Really, we would have shifted sooner but I was jet||lagged from 30 hours of transit from the U.S. back home and, really, could it get any worse? Well, yes. Day 2 I awoke to find a construction worker on the access balcony outside our room's window. At 0605 hours. Peering in. Silly me. We were on the 4th floor, why did I need to worry about drawing the drapes. He smiled and waved. This would be a great place to stash your hated mother-in-law, worst enemy or evil boss. The staff seem to be taking their hospitality cues from binge-watching the PURGE movie series. The ONLY redeeming factor is the SM Mall located about 0.3 km away. So, you can always look forward to shopping. Like I said, the WORST hotel experience in memory. We fled. There are a few decent hotels in Bacolod. This is NOT one of them. Stay clear and far away...

I booked this hotel online and based on the published pictures, I was impressed enough. What a big disappointment. The Premium Suite that I paid top money for, was nothing but a stuffy, smelly, dilapidated room. I asked what was special about this so-called suite and was told it’s because of the carpeting. Are you kidding me? The carpet was very old and faded and torn in the middle. The TV was old and did not work. Drawers and closet doors fell to the floor when opened. The bathroom faucet was hard to turn and the sink needed a good scrubbing. The shower head was moldy and the “white” towels were gray and worn out. They even charge for an extra towel. They hesitantly moved us to a regular room, which was slightly better and cheaper than the premium suite.||The free breakfast was limited to Filipino choices only and came in small portions. Coffee came in a very tiny cup, maybe 6 oz. at the most, and coffee refills are extra. ||The only plus at this hotel are the friendly bellboys and room attendants. The owners definitely need to invest more money and time on this hotel as it really needs a lot of attention and issues that should be attended to. Our stay was not quite as bad as the rest of the reviews are, we stayed there for a week with my family (3 of us, two adults and one two-year-old child) even though at first we were given a rough room with no windows, I did not hesitate to make a request if they can give us a better room. They were actually quite helpful and assisted us all the way. I have no issues with the receptionists and the workers were nice and respectful towards us. We had no issues as well with the cleanliness of the place as they cleaned up our room when we do make a request. I think one of a few minor blunders I have is that there is no laundry service on-site and yes the aircon needs some major cleaning. Other than that, this hotel is suitable for a quick stay and also very close to SM and nearby areas where you don't need to get a taxi. If you are working remotely, the internet connection is somewhat intermittent and you may have to bring your own mobile connection that is higher than expected. HIGH EXPECTATIONS FOR LOW RESULTS OPT FOR OTHER HOTELS So. Many. Cockroaches. They LIVE in SKIRTINGS and HEADBOARDS. We had to move our beds so they would stop crawling to the sheets — The attached picture only consists of a few bugs we killed. (Compiled to show the front desk upon check-out) The WIFI is UNRELIABLE. Not suitable for remote work or online students. The "free Wi-Fi" are just daily passes that run out at obscure times. The staff are friendly and help the best they can (Lord bless them), but it amounts to nothing if the HOTEL HYGIENE is DISGUSTING. Others, The refrigerators do not work and have no manual for them to be able to work. The complimentary glasses placed inside toilets are not clean. They are foggy and do not seem to be cleaned or switched out regularly. The phone in the room is useless. There is no emergency contact list even for the front desk. And again, DIRTY

Pretty well maintained hotel, I love their rooms and beds. Good quality bedsheets and mattresses. Priced at Php1,580 STD room and Php1,780 for DELUXE room without breakfast does not sound too expensive in my opinion. Very near SM, with just a minute walk. Properly situated near city hall and downtown area. Staff are friendly. It has a bar on the 2nd floor (entered through outside stairs-case), a restaurant on the ground floor and a pool for adults and children on the 2nd floor. Overall stay is good, I’ve been staying in this place for several times and I have no complaints. Would have been 5 stars if staff don’t change so often so I don’t need to look like a new walk-in client every time.

Hotel staff was accommodating and nice. We arrived at 2:15 and check in after five minutes. We reserved two rooms, Deluxe and Premiere. Both rooms are clean. Toiletries and bath towels were provided during the stay. The pool is nice and good for dipping after a long, tiring day. It looks great at night with the lights as well. Designated smoking area near the pool area. Pool opens at 8AM-10PM.
